The Last House on the Street
When two beautiful college girls move across the street from Derek and Chad, sinister things begin to happen.
Having trouble? Try a different server from the list.
When two beautiful college girls move across the street from Derek and Chad, sinister things begin to happen.
Having trouble? Try a different server from the list.